Local Weather Risks in Cedar Creek
Triggers
High winds (40+ mph) common along the Colorado River valley can lift and tear shingles. Hail events — even pea-sized — can compromise asphalt shingle granules and create delayed leaks. Heavy rain following drought can exploit cracks and dried-out seals. Sudden temperature drops can cause thermal shock and split flashing seals.
Seasonal Risks
Roofing emergencies in Cedar Creek spike during spring and fall storm seasons, when severe thunderstorms and hail are most common. Late-summer heat can also cause sudden shingle failure on older roofs. Winter freeze events, though less frequent, can lead to ice dam formation and flash freezing of roof drainage systems.
Disaster Scenarios
Post-storm: Widespread shingle loss, torn flashing, exposed underlayment. Flooding event: Prolonged saturation can rot decking and collapse compromised roof sections. Winter freeze: Ice dams can force water under shingles; thaw cycles cause sudden interior flooding. Wildfire aftermath: Heat exposure can weaken or embrittle roofing materials, requiring immediate assessment for safety.

Emergency Prevention Tips
- ✓ Inspect your attic monthly for stains, damp insulation, or daylight peeking through roof boards
- ✓ Clean gutters and downspouts before storm seasons — clogs force water under shingles
- ✓ Trim overhanging branches that could fall on the roof during high winds
- ✓ After any hailstorm, check for bruising on shingles (soft spots, lost granules) even if no leak is visible
- ✓ Seal and flash all roof penetrations (vents, skylights, chimneys) before winter and spring rains
- ✓ Document your roof condition with dated photos — this helps speed up insurance claims after an emergency
